How We Work
1
Emergency Contact
Your urgent call initiates our rapid response. We gather critical information, assess the water damage over the phone, and dispatch a certified team to your Sugar Land location immediately to prevent further damage.
2
On-Site Assessment
Upon arrival, our technicians use moisture meters and thermal imaging to accurately map the extent of water intrusion. This detailed inspection informs our comprehensive drying plan and prepares for water extraction.
3
Water Extraction & Drying
High-powered pumps and industrial-grade extractors remove standing water. We then strategically place dehumidifiers and air movers to thoroughly dry affected areas, preventing mold growth and preparing for restoration.
4
Cleaning & Sanitizing
Contaminated materials are safely removed. We apply antimicrobial treatments to sanitize all surfaces, ensuring a clean and healthy environment. This step ensures readiness for structural repairs and reconstruction.
5
Restoration & Final Walkthrough
Our skilled craftsmen repair or replace damaged building materials, restoring your property to its pre-damage condition. A final walkthrough ensures your complete satisfaction with our work and the restored space.

Concrete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ill with minimal damage Yes No DIY methods can be effective for small spills
Large water spill with significant damage No Yes Professional equipment and expertise are necessary for large-scale damage
Concrete water damage with visible cracks or unevenness No Yes Professional repair or replacement is necessary to ensure structural integrity
Water damage with visible signs of mold or mildew No Yes Professional equipment and expertise are necessary to safely remove mold and mildew
Water damage with unknown source or extent No Yes Professional investigation and assessment are necessary to find out the root cause and scope of the damage
Water damage with high-risk materials or equipment No Yes Professional expertise and equipment are necessary to safely handle high-risk materials or equipment

Concrete Water Damage Restoration Cost In Liberty, TX

The cost of concrete water damage restoration can vary widely depending on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Liberty, TX. Expect to pay anywhere from $500 to $2,500 or more depending on the scope of the damage and the level of expertise required.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ction and Drying $500 - $1,500 Severity and size of the affected area
Concrete Repair and Restoration $1,000 - $3,000 Complexity and extent of the repair
Final Inspection and Cleaning $200 - $500 Size of the affected area
Equipment Rental and Fuel $100 - $300 Size of the affected area and number of equipment required
Travel and Labor Fees $200 - $500 Distance and time required to complete the job
More Services (mold remediation, etc.) $500 - $1,000 Scope and complexity of the more services required
